J. Leigh Bralick Ahhh!!!! I love this question so much!!!! :D (And it makes me so happy to hear that someone besides me is fangirling over them...LOL!)

This answer may contain spoilers for The Madness Project... I forgot to mark it as spoiler-y when I submitted it and now the button has disappeared. So proceed at your own risk. ;-)

~~~~
It's such a good question. I love the scene where Hayli and Tarik meet, because I just love the scene in general, with Zagger being all scowly and stern and Tarik's surprise when he touches Hayli's hand, and how she sees straight to that part of him he tries to hide from society, and she wants to hate him but can't help kinda sorta totally crushing on him either. And it's kind of fun for the reader because we know who they both are—we've already seen the world through both their eyes—and so seeing them meet for the first time, seeing their worlds colliding for the first time, is just so fun.

But then the scene when Hayli and Shade meet...it was such a fun scene to write, because we see a little of Hayli's prickly side, but we feel like we're in on the big secret because we know Shade is Tarik and that he knows who Hayli is but is pretending he doesn't, and acting all smart-alecky when he "guesses" that she's a mage. And he's so miserable but he's trying so hard to act tough and mysterious, and Hayli's all, "Psh, I'm so not impressed.....but tell me more." :-P And it also introduces that tortured part of their relationship at the beginning, where he's trying so hard to keep her at a distance, and can't explain why.

*sigh* So yeah. I loved writing both of them...I still can't decide which was my favorite!

I will say one of my favorite "meeting" scenes to write was with Hayli and Tarik both sneaking around in the Science Ministry and running into each other. That scene was just a ton of fun to write. :)
